    - Why are numbers sometimes incorrectly determined?
    Due to a number of features of regional code entries, phone firmware often compares phones by the last digits. Therefore, sometimes it turns out that one of two or three hundred contacts in your phone book can be defined as the other, if the “tails” of the numbers are similar. On a number of old firmware, the last 7 digits are enough.

    - What is emergency phone unlocking?
    This is the mode that is used to dial emergency numbers (112), for example, calling an ambulance. Any phone, regardless of the presence / absence of a password, installed software and SIM card, must be unlocked for this case. If the unlock method is not obvious, most often you just need to press 112 or hold the pound key for 3 seconds. Other - more exotic - unlock methods are described in the telephone instructions.

    - Where did I get the unknown numbers from the last dialed?
    Depending on the phone software, both the last number dialed and the last one with which the connection was established can be saved. This means that if there was a call forwarding, the final number will be saved, and not the one you started dialing.

    - How are stations installed in permafrost?
    At first glance, permafrost is a layer of earth that is frozen to the state of stone. Nevertheless, a warm BS from above can melt this layer, and the foundation will “float”. Therefore, seasonally operating cooling devices are used - pressurized tubes with refrigerant.

    - What is LTE-A?
    LTE-A is a standard that describes the evolution of LTE networks. It includes many different improvements, in particular in Russia it is already possible to use the function of combining two frequency ranges to obtain a larger band (and therefore higher speed) for traffic. Among other things, it is worth noting that LTE-A will provide much better access where previously the speed was low due to interference like buildings.

    - Why, when I ride the usual fast train from Moscow to St. Petersburg, the signal in the compartment was much better than in the Sapsan?
    Because the Sapsan has metal in the windows, which screens the train well enough. Accordingly, the signal in it will be weaker. That is why we built a chain of base stations near the railway tracks. In this case, signal attenuation should not be confused with the Doppler effect or the effect of speed reduction in 3G networks when a subscriber moves due to network delay.

    - When will there be VoLTE?
    Currently, voice services and SMS are possible in Russia’s LTE networks thanks to the use of Circuit Switched FallBack technology - temporary switching in 3G / 2G network to establish a voice connection. This creates a lot of problems on the network, so we moved on to the next level of the standard - VoLTE (in the pilot project, the planned launch over the network is yet to come).     - What is SDR / SDN?
    To simplify, this is somewhat similar to virtualization of iron: a change in the functional does not occur by replacing the material part, but by changing its software part. This is the philosophy of building new radio networks.     - What are the difficulties of installation in the southern regions of the Russian Federation?
    In Astrakhan, for example, there is a complete set of difficulties. The wind breaks everything poorly fixed, and in the winter it blows so that it seems that you are climbing into the tower in only your underpants. Insects clog freecooling filters. Vipers like to lie under containers in the steppe because it is cool there. Birds hammer everything shiny. The heat inside the container without active cooling can be up to +80. The picture is effectively complemented by the relief (making BS maintenance difficult), the need for RRL instead of cable, floods and charismatic local residents.

    - How is the launch of the BS coordinated by radiation standards?
    First, before construction, radiation is calculated on the basis of data on buildings in both the vertical and horizontal planes. It turns out the project passport. Then, an examination of the projects is carried out: external organizations check the calculations, if necessary, make adjustments, for example, change the location of the antennas. An expert opinion is given. Based on these documents, Rospotrebnadzor gives its permission after additional examination - a sanitary and epidemiological conclusion is obtained on the placement of a radio transmitting facility. Upon completion of work, an inclusion is made at the time of measurement, sensors are located at control points. SanPin compliance is checked. Then the certified organization gives a second expert opinion. After that, the facility is put into operation .

    - Where is safer to say - closer to the BS or further from it?
    The total electromagnetic radiation is less closer to the base station. The fact is that a close low-power source (telephone) gives an order of magnitude greater radiation than a more powerful, but distant base station.
